Former minister Elena Udrea has withdrawn her application for parole and will submit a new one after the prison board's evaluation.

Elena Udrea has decided to withdraw her request for conditional release registered at the Ploiești court, according to judicial sources. She will make a new request after the evaluation by the parole commission of the Targsor Penitentiary. Recently, the Prahova court admitted an appeal, reducing her six-year prison sentence in the 'Gala Bute' case by about eight months. Udrea, who was jailed in June 2022 after extradition from Bulgaria, is charged with corruption, with an estimated €3 million in damages.
